Trauma is a lasting emotional response that often results from living through a distressing event. Trauma can result from exposure to an incident or series of events that are emotionally disturbing or life-threatening with lasting effects. Traumatic events can include physical harm, emotional harm, and/or life-threatening circumstances. The original ACE Study asked people to indicate the number of traumatic events they had experienced prior to age 18 and provided them with a corresponding “ACE score.” Compared to people with no ACEs, individuals with an ACE score of four or more were more likely to engage in health-risk behaviors. Trauma can cause a person to experience emotions, flashbacks, strained relationships, and even physical symptoms like headaches or nausea. Trauma-informed care refers to therapeutic approaches that validate and are tailored to the unique experience of a person coping with PTSD.
